Transaction 85318a409fd8d668d9d57fb98e8ca2f7f9584ea59bf10eb6e7d961674c291f8e
1 Input
1 Output
-
85318a409fd8d668d9d57fb98e8ca2f7f9584ea59bf10eb6e7d961674c291f8e:0
- value
- 18220282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d85edeb7aa37c2ef2d3820d761ba25e63f3e1f2 OP_EQUAL
- address
- 34P7xgZYfxBnwMHNgBndm3RPRYRaY5MUC4